Domainkey dns bind software

But avoid asking for help, clarification, or responding to other answers. Thanks for contributing an answer to stack overflow. This is the dns record you should add if you want to point a domain name to a web server. Bind, developed by students at the university of california, is an acronym for berkeley internet name domain. The problem seems to be in the fact that bind my dns server for that zone doesnt support records that are more than 255 characters long in the zone file. If you already have one or more current simple dns plus licenses and want to add one more of the same size, you can buy this additional license at the 2 or more licenses rate from the table above above. Phpbind is a complete php class for managing binds configuration files.

Enter the domain youd like to generate keys for, for example and hit the button. Configuring dns records for domainkeys dkim simple dns. The file is parsed and checked for syntax errors, along with all files included by it. Almost every internet connection starts with a dns lookup.

Dns workflow bind dns software configure a wildcard domain. If your domain is hosted by windows dns server in local lan. I recommend you to use a webbased control panel where you can update web and mail records and have the results reflected on your dns servers within minutes. This online wizard is fine for generating keys for testing and evaluation. How to create a dkim record and add it to dns mailtrap blog. Its like using stickynotes to pin client feedback and track bugs directly on a page. Regardless of which method you use to provision your public dkim key in the dns, ensure that afterwards it can be looked up by the receivers ie, the public key is available in the dns. Solved cname and office365 domainkey cpanel forums.

The key pair will be used for both domainkeys and dkim signing. I was able to get dkim working fine on an external dns using the instructions above copying the txt entry from my pleskinstalled dns bind zone files. Using no outside resources, and implemented completely within php it offers full control of nf and associated or not domain db files. Without a dns record, your dkim setup is completely nonfunctional. How to split dns dkim records properly hack w limbic media. After you added a domain in dkim plugin manager, you can select the domain and click deploy key, input your dns server address and choose the dns zone, the public key. Once logged in, direct your way to my domain names and click on edit dns. Net code is not being tagged with the dkim or domainkey for some domains.

It translates domain names to numerical ip addresses used to locate services and devices worldwide, and associates details with domain names assigned to. Bind allows you to create custom domains to serve emails and websites, and answer queries from around the world. The domainkeysignature header and signature is added to the email and the message is sent. Thus, if the selector field contains the value allmail and the domainname field is then a dns txt query is issued for allmail. Axigen is a fast, reliable and secure linux, windows, and solaris mail server software, offering integrated smtp, pop3, imap, and webmail servers, enabling. If there is no file is specified with the command, etcnf is read by default. Setup dns records for your iredmail server a, ptr, mx. This is usually the most often used record type in any dns system.

Before removing a key from dns, a new key should be put into the dns records and the outbound mta should begin using it. Noerror a publickey p is required thing is, i have set up the dk on my registrats dns, which is the assigned dns namecheap. A records map a fqdn fully qualified domain name to an ip address. The individual domains all have dns zone files, but the main host does not have a zone file that i can find. Configuring dns for dkim in kerio connect gfi support. Creating dkim txt records in windows dns powered by. Sites wishing to use dkim will require the publication of their public keys in the corresponding dns zones, so that receivers can access them. The public key in kerio connect includes two parts.

Policy records are no longer included as they are part of the deprecated domainkeys, and not dkim. After several different tries, here is my setup on namecheap. If you decide to use dkim core in production, though, you might want to. Configuring dns records for domainkeys dkim simple dns plus. Simple dns plus runs on all client and server versions of windows xp2003 up to current versions. K30222115 configuring dkim dns txt resource records. Dns is the workhorse underlying any network, and bind is the most common linux implementation of dns. Due to the recently released vulnerability related to the use of weak cryptographic dkim keys, i wrote a tool to check dkim records and determine their public key length. This last step assumes you are using bind on your ubuntu server. This is necessary for dkim key rotation which changes the private key of a key pair periodically.

If you use a bind dns server, you can split the original kerio connect dkim public key txt value by using the following format. How to configure bind as a private network dns server on. Deploy domainkeysdkim public key in dns server emailarchitect. If your domain is hosted by bind dns server, you can add dkim public key record like this.

If you would like to contribute to isc to assist them in continuing to make quality open source software. Configure a dns service with wildcards for virtual hosting. Dns root key rollover update internet systems consortium. Benchmarking dns reliably on multicore systems internet. A, mx records are required, reverse ptr, spf, dkim and dmarc are optional but highly recommended a record for server hostname what is an a record. We explain how to create the public private key pair, configure the dns record, generate and save the dkim signature. Before your mail server sends an email, before your web browser displays a web page, there is a dns lookup to resolve a dns name to an ip address. Log file can give out required information but dnstop is just like top command for monitoring dns traffic. Searching for a opportunity to easily administer your domain names. There are basically two types of dns records used by domainkeys. It performs both of the main dns server roles, acting as an authoritative name server for domains, and. Authoritative dns serial check accepts a domain name and finds the authoritative name servers primary and secondary, then it queries each name server for the current serial number for the zone defining the domain, then it presents and analyzes the results. Setting up dkim setup dns zone syntax error on bind in.

How do i find out who is querying my dns server or specific domain or specific dns client ip address. Domainkeys is a spam and phishing scam fighting method which works by signing outbound email messages with a cryptographic signature which can be verified by the recipient to determine if the messages originates from an authorized system. This provides a central way to manage your internal hostnames and private ip addresses, which is. Previously, i introduced you to bind, or berkeley internet name domain, the most common software package for implementing dns services, and showed you how to set it on a linux server. Start menu administrative tools dns expand the nodes on your dns server and select the target domain where you will be adding the two dkim txt records. How to create, configure and implement dkim in 3 easy steps. It does a dns lookup on the txt record to fetch the publickey for the senders domain. As can be seen, dkim uses the dns as a trusted mechanism to distribute its public keys to the large and diverse population of mail receivers. It is a small tool to listen on device or to parse the file savefile and collect and print statistics on the local networks dns. Yes, you can have multiple dkim records, txt or cnametyped, on a single domain. Dkim uses dns to publish the public keys, so that any party that wants to validate a signature can easily find the public key. Get the details here including instructions for 15 dns providers.

A domain name using domainkeys should have a single policy record configured. This course covers how to configure bind dns on a centos 7 server, including coverage of different lookup records and zone types. Command namedcheckconf checks the syntax only of a named bind configuration file. Dkim domainkeys identified mail is an important authentication mechanism to help protect both email receivers and email senders from forged and phishing email. In this tutorial, we will go over how to set up an internal dns server, using the bind name server software bind9 on ubuntu 14.

I am trying to enter dkim into dns zone for the domain i have a dedicated server hosting about 20 domains. After you added a domain in dkim plugin manager, you can select the domain and click deploy key, input your dns server address and choose the dns zone, the public key will be deployed to dns server automatically. Locate your domains zone file and open it with your preferred editor. Then proceed to test the validity of the signing process. How to enter dkim record into dns zone cpanel forums. Next you will need to click on the manage advanced dns records. There are several email addresses set up to autorespond to a domainkey signed message with verification results. The process of adding a dkim record to your dns may vary according to your provider.

Below is a list of free bind management tools what allow me to maintain the dns servers. Domainkeys uses dns txtrecords to define domainkeys policy and. I am using a 2048 bits long rsa key to sign my mails at the mail relay level this works ok and i indeed have dkim headers in the mails relayed through this server. If you have ever had the opportunity to fiddle around with email servers, you might have heard of dkim or domainkey records. Overview the domain name system dns is a hierarchical distributed naming system for resources on the internet or a private network.

After all mtas have stopped using the key to be retired for at least five days preferably 14, the key record can be removed from the dns records entirely. If your dns server software provides tuning parameters especially relating to how many processes or threads it will use, it is vital that you benchmark against your own expected traffic patterns and various combinations of those parameters until you find the values that work best for you on. Once in your dns area, click on the domain you would like to implement your dkim record. Now, in the part just below the list of dns disallowed characters it does say that it is properly used as the first char of srv records and may be supported anywhere by newer dns servers. Dkim records are a way to fight the bad guys by adding an encrypted signature to your emails so that the recipient can check to see if the email originates from an authorized system. Specifically, they have announced that the 11 october 2017 date that was planned for the retirement of ksk2010 will be postponed for at least three months because root zone trust anchor telemetry data sent by servers running bind 9 and other dns server software indicates that many operators are still unprepared for the change and using soonto. The domain name system dns is the system created to map domain names to ip addresses, and is largely responsible for the widespread popularity of the internet due to the convenience it offers in calling system resources by an easily recognizable name rather than a cryptic number. Once in the domain you selected, click on the edit dns tab. The problem seems to be in the fact that bind my dns server for that zone doesnt support records that are more than 255 characters long in. This produces public keys that exceed the limitation of binds txt resource record of 255 characters in a single string. I have one issue that seems to be really impacting me though.

If you use alternate dns management software provided by your isp or hosting, please consult its documentation on how to add a txt record to your domain. So far it works for my initial domain, the second domain however im having issues with. When you create multiple dkim records, you need to choose a selector that is unique across all dkim records on that domain. I have a rather simple question, that i could not find an answer. Dkim wizard this wizard will allow you to easily create a public and private key pair to be used for domainkeys and dkim signing within powermta. Bind dns software from the internet systems consortium isc is among the leading reference implementations for dns deployed worldwide and is available for free download. After you added a domain in dkim plugin manager, you can select the domain and click deploy. I have my dns zone in godaddy and current dns for mytestdomain is.

321 1304 1428 922 838 1368 484 449 1531 957 1226 429 907 1583 95 1075 255 432 864 1363 614 518 1131 691 861 1417 983 739 867 435 1129 710 874 1282 525 430